Mini split sizing refers to the process of determining the appropriate cooling capacity (in tons) needed for a space based on its BTU (British Thermal Unit) requirements. Proper sizing ensures efficient operation and optimal comfort.

Explanation: This formula converts BTU requirements to tons, which is the standard measurement for air conditioning system capacity.
Details: Correct mini split sizing is crucial for energy efficiency, proper humidity control, and system longevity. Oversized units short cycle, while undersized units struggle to maintain temperature.

Q1: Why is 12,000 used in the conversion?
A: One ton of cooling capacity equals 12,000 BTU per hour, which is the standard conversion factor in the HVAC industry.
Q2: How do I determine the BTU requirements for my space?
A: BTU requirements depend on room size, insulation, windows, climate, and other factors. Professional load calculations are recommended.
Q3: What's the typical tonnage for residential spaces?
A: Most residential rooms require 0.5-2 tons, while whole-house systems may need 2-5 tons depending on square footage.
Q4: Can I use this for heat pump sizing?
A: Yes, the same tonnage calculation applies for both cooling and heating modes in mini split systems.
Q5: Should I round up or down when selecting a unit?
A: It's generally better to round up to the nearest available unit size rather than down to ensure adequate capacity.
